Toyota Canada to Deploy Agility Robotics’ Digit in Manufacturing Facilities

Toyota Canada Ushers in New Era of Manufacturing with Agility Robotics’ Digit

Cambridge, Ontario – Toyota Motor Manufacturing Canada (TMMC) is taking a significant step into the future of automotive production with the deployment of humanoid robots from Agility Robotics. Following a successful year-long pilot program, TMMC will integrate seven Digit robots into its Woodstock, Ontario facility this April, marking a pivotal moment in the adoption of advanced robotics within the Canadian manufacturing sector.

Digit: A General-Purpose Robot for Logistics and Manufacturing

Agility’s Digit is a general-purpose humanoid robot specifically engineered for logistics and manufacturing environments. Unlike traditional industrial robots confined to fixed positions, Digit is designed to navigate dynamic spaces and perform a variety of tasks. The initial deployment at TMMC will focus on loading and unloading totes from automated tuggers, streamlining material handling processes.

Peggy Johnson, CEO of Agility Robotics, emphasized the collaborative nature of this technology. “Toyota is one of the premier companies in the world…so it’s a privilege to join forces to integrate humanoid robotic solutions like Digit into automotive production.” She similarly highlighted the future potential, stating that Agility’s next generation of Digit will be the first cooperatively safe humanoid robot capable of scaling beyond current limitations.

Robots-as-a-Service: A Flexible Approach to Automation

TMMC is utilizing a Robots-as-a-Service (RaaS) model, which offers a flexible and cost-effective way to integrate robotics into operations. This approach minimizes upfront investment and allows companies to scale their automation efforts based on demonstrated results. Digit moved bins at a GXO Logistics facility using a similar RaaS model.

Beyond Toyota: A Growing Trend in Humanoid Robotics

Toyota isn’t alone in embracing humanoid robotics. Agility Robotics’ customer base includes other Fortune 500 companies like GXO, Schaeffler, and Amazon, signaling a broader industry trend. This growing adoption is fueled by advancements in AI, robotics, and the increasing demand for automation to address labor shortages and improve efficiency.

Frequently Asked Questions

What is the Robots-as-a-Service (RaaS) model?
RaaS allows companies to lease robots instead of purchasing them outright, reducing upfront costs and providing flexibility.

What types of tasks will Digit perform at TMMC?
Initially, Digit will focus on loading and unloading totes from automated tuggers, but the companies will explore other applications.

Will robots replace human workers at TMMC?
No, Digit is designed to augment the workforce by handling repetitive and physically demanding tasks, freeing up employees for more value-added work.

What makes Digit different from traditional industrial robots?
Digit is a humanoid robot designed to navigate dynamic spaces and perform a variety of tasks, unlike traditional robots that are fixed in place.

Where is Agility Robotics headquartered?
Agility Robotics is headquartered in Salem, Oregon, with offices in Pittsburgh, Pennsylvania and Palo Alto, California.
